溫馨提示×

hive export能導出特定格式嗎

小樊
90
2024-12-20 16:53:01
欄目: 大數據

是的,Hive的export命令支持導出特定格式的數據。你可以使用SELECT ... INTO OUTFILE語句將查詢結果導出為不同的文件格式,例如CSV、JSON、Parquet等。以下是一些示例:

  1. 導出為CSV格式:
SELECT * FROM table_name WHERE condition
INTO OUTFILE '/path/to/output/file.csv'
FIELDS TERMINATED BY ','
LINES TERMINATED BY '\n';
  1. 導出為JSON格式:
SELECT * FROM table_name WHERE condition
INTO OUTFILE '/path/to/output/file.json'
ROW FORMAT SERDE 'org.openx.data.jsonserde.JsonSerDe';
  1. 導出為Parquet格式:
SELECT * FROM table_name WHERE condition
INTO OUTFILE '/path/to/output/file.parquet'
STORED AS PARQUET;

請注意,你需要根據你的需求和環境調整這些示例。在實際使用時,請確保你有足夠的權限在指定的目錄中創建和寫入文件,并注意文件路徑和格式的正確性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女